Uncertainty Over Eagles, Guinea Clash

With less than four days to the African Cup of Nations qualifier against Sily National of  Guinea, Nigeria’s Super Eagles are still in the dark whether the match will go ahead as  planned.

Coaches and players of the senior national team are worried that with the FIFA ban still  in place, the qualifier may not hold. But a report from Guinea early today revealed that  coach of the Eagles’ opponents,  Frenchman Michel Dussuyer, has received a notice from  the Guinea Football Federation that the crucial match has been postponed.

Dussuyer said: “We received a fax this morning from the Guinea football federation,  confirming to us the Guinea-Nigeria match has been postponed till further notice. No  reasons were given. We’re waiting for further clarifications.”

Eagles’ coach, Austin Eguavoen, who is confused with the way the whole scenario is being  played out at this time that his team should focus on their training for the match said:  “We, the coaches and players, are waiting and hoping that the crisis comes to an end very  soon so that we can return to international football.”
